St. Clair Extension to Host Blue & White Prostate & Lung Cancer Awareness Luncheon
Currently, according to the Centers for Disease Control (CDC), the two most prevalent types of cancer in St. Clair County just under breast cancer are prostate and lung cancer.
The CDC sites prostate cancer as being the most common, non-skin cancer among American men followed by lung cancer which is the leading cause of cancer death and the second most common cancer among both men and women in the United States.
To increase awareness of these types of cancer, the St. Clair County Extension Office is proud to announce that we will host a Blue & White Prostate & Lung Cancer Awareness Luncheon on Tuesday, Oct. 10 from 11 a.m.—1 p.m. at the Pell City Civic Center. Dr. Tyler Poston, Urology Centers of AL
Dr. Tyler Poston was born in Washington, DC, but raised in Birmingham. He completed his undergraduate degree at the University of Alabama where he earned a B.A. in Advertising with minor in Biology. Dr. Poston then completed his medical degree at the University of Alabama’s School of Medicine, where he was a member of Alpha Omega Alpha honor society. He then completed his internship in General Surgery and residency in Urology at UAB before joining Urology Centers of Alabama. Dr. Poston’s special interests of care include: comprehensive urological care, robotic and laparoscopic surgery, management of genitourinary malignancies, erectile dysfunction, male/female incontinence, medical and surgical management of kidney stones, medical and surgical management of BPH, male infertility, and upper/lower urinary tract reconstruction.

Ashley Lyerly, MPA, American Lung Association Regional Director of Public Policy, Southeast Region
The American Lung Association strives to save lives by improving lung health and preventing lung disease through education, advocacy, and research. As the Regional Director of Public Policy, Ashley Lyerly guides the American Lung Association’s advocacy activities on tobacco control, healthy air, and other lung health issues across Alabama, Arkansas, Louisiana and Mississippi. Ashley joined the American Lung Association as the Director of Advocacy in Alabama in October 2011. In this position, she was responsible for facilitating the policy priorities across the State, including leading local smoke-free campaigns and managing the local and state tobacco free coalitions. Prior to joining the American Lung Association, Ashley was a Project Facilitator for United Way of Central Alabama addressing tobacco control and prevention strategies. In addition to her previous work in tobacco control, she has a background working on financial stability issues with the low to moderate income population as the Manager of Workforce Development and Financial Stability for United Way Worldwide. Ashley Lyerly has a Bachelor of Arts in Urban Studies from Rhodes College and a Masters of Public Administration from the George Washington University.
